| Tagline | Vercel's AI-powered UI generator. Prompt to shadcn component. | The one that actually gets text in images right. | VS Code fork that made AI coding actually work. | Cognition Labs' autonomous coding engineer. |
| Category | design | image | coding | agents |
| Pricing | Free + $20/mo | Free + $8/mo + $20/mo + $60/mo | Free + $20/mo Pro + $40/mo Business | $500/mo |
| Best for | Frontend devs, PMs prototyping UIs, anyone on Next.js. | Anything with text — posters, ads, album covers, slide decks. | Developers. Non-developers who want to ship working code. | Engineering teams offloading tickets. Ops/platform work. |
